Silver Dollar Casino closure in SeaTac follows Maverick bankruptcy filing
Maverick Gaming announced this week that it plans to close its Silver Dollar SeaTac Casino and lay off about 65 employees as part of ongoing restructuring tied to its bankruptcy proceedings.According to a worker notification filing, the Kirkland-based company expects the job cuts to take effect June 30.
